Question: the secornd un in Exercise 9.1 contained the entry -S aborts in the log in Exercise 9.1 lace of the entry p5 tem is using
the secornd un in Exercise 9.1 contained the entry -S aborts in the log in Exercise 9.1 lace of the entry p5 tem is using immediate updates and the crash occurred the rollback took place, what changes, if any, would you is a If the before make hin tem were using deferred updates, what changes would in the recovery process? b. If the s Dmak in the recovery process of Exercise 9.2? you yme the following transactions are to be performed Transaction S: read(a 05a +10 write(a) read b) b-b5 write(b) Transaction T: read(o); write a; a. If the initial value of a is 10 and the initial value of b is 20, what are their final values if we perform the transactions serially, using order S,T? b. Using the same initial values, what are the final values of a and b if the order of execution is T,S? c. Does this result have any implications for serializability? Write a concurrent schedule for transactions S and T in Exercise 9.4 that illustrates the lost update problem. 9.5 9.6 Apply the standard two-phase locking protocol to the schedule you devised in Exercise 9.5. Will the protocol allow the execution of that schedule? Does deadlock occur? the secornd un in Exercise 9.1 contained the entry -S aborts in the log in Exercise 9.1 lace of the entry p5 tem is using immediate updates and the crash occurred the rollback took place, what changes, if any, would you is a If the before make hin tem were using deferred updates, what changes would in the recovery process? b. If the s Dmak in the recovery process of Exercise 9.2? you yme the following transactions are to be performed Transaction S: read(a 05a +10 write(a) read b) b-b5 write(b) Transaction T: read(o); write a; a. If the initial value of a is 10 and the initial value of b is 20, what are their final values if we perform the transactions serially, using order S,T? b. Using the same initial values, what are the final values of a and b if the order of execution is T,S? c. Does this result have any implications for serializability? Write a concurrent schedule for transactions S and T in Exercise 9.4 that illustrates the lost update problem. 9.5 9.6 Apply the standard two-phase locking protocol to the schedule you devised in Exercise 9.5. Will the protocol allow the execution of that schedule? Does deadlock occur
Step by Step Solution
There are 3 Steps involved in it
Get step-by-step solutions from verified subject matter experts
